From: CAR exosomes derived from effector CAR-T cells have potent antitumour effects and low toxicity

Fig. 1

Generation and characterization of CAR-T cells. a Vector maps of tested CAR designs. b Membrane-bound CAR expression. Forty-eight hours after retroviral transduction, the expression of CAR on human T cells was detected by staining with anti-MYC antibody, followed by flow cytometry analysis. T cells without transduction were used as a negative control. The histograms shown in black correspond to the isotype controls, whereas the red histograms indicate the positive fluorescence. c Killing activity of CAR-T cells in response to tumour cells. The cytotoxic activity of CAR-T and control T cells against cancer cell lines was assessed by a 51Cr-release assay at the indicated effector-to-target (E:T) ratios. Results shown represent three (b) independent experiments. Data are means ± s.d. of five (c) independent biological replicates. P values are from a two-way ANOVA followed by the Bonferroni post-test (c). Source data (c) are provided as a Source Data file
